**Piedmont Physicians Occupational Medicine: Your Trusted Partner in Workplace Health Solutions** Located conveniently at 485 US-29 in Athens, Georgia, Piedmont Physicians Occupational Medicine specializes in providing comprehensive occupational health services to local businesses and employees. With a focus on workplace wellness, the clinic offers a range of services including physical examinations, drug testing, and various health assessments tailored to meet the needs of employers and their teams.
